@charset "utf-8";
/* CSS Document */

.q{clear:both; background:#EAE3EA; background-image:url(../img/ec-cube/q.gif); background-repeat:no-repeat; background-position:top; padding:5px 5px 5px 45px; line-height:20px; min-height:20px;}
.a{clear:both; background:url(../img/ec-cube/a.gif) no-repeat 0 top; padding:6px 0 20px 45px; line-height:150%; min-height:24px;}



#siteImg{background:#F0F0F0; background-repeat:no-repeat; background-position:top; margin-bottom:10px;}
#siteImg:after{content:"."; display:block; visibility:hidden; height:0.1px; font-size:0.1em; line-height:0; clear:both;}
#siteImg{zoom:1;}


#ec-cube-list{color:#696969; font-size:11px; line-height:20px;}
#ec-cube-list img{vertical-align:sub;}
* html #ec-cube-list img{vertical-align:middle;}
*:first-child + html #ec-cube-list img{vertical-align:middle;}
html>/**/body #ec-cube-list img{vertical-align/*\**/:middle\9;}








